Bangladeshi traders seek approval to import 510 million eggs from India
Traders in Bangladesh are seeking government approval to import 510 million eggs from India to cope with a current egg shortage in the country, even though local output is sufficient to meet demand, The Financial Express reported.

Pakistan imported six million tonnes of wheat at US$2 billion over two year period
Pakistan has imported more than six million tonnes of wheat between July 2020 until September 2022 worth over US$2 billion to close the gap between supply and demand as local output has declined, Dawn reported.

Fonterra to pay US$16 million to settle class action lawsuit over milk payment cuts
Fonterra has agreed to pay AUD 25 million (~US$16 million; AUD 1 = US$0.64) to settle a class action lawsuit filed against the company by Australian dairy farmers over reduced milk payments in 2016, Stuff New Zealand reported.

Honduras shrimp exports generate US$222.3 million
Shrimp aquaculture producers in Honduras said shrimp exports have generated US$222.3 million by the end of the third quarter of this year, shipping 53.2 million pounds of shrimp, Fish Information & Services reported.

Tyson Foods to pay US$10.5 million to settle poultry price-fixing lawsuit
Major US meatpacker Tyson Foods will pay US$10.5 million to settle a class action lawsuit that alleges the company increased poultry prices in the US state of Washington since 2008, Food Dive reported.

Russia to set grain export quota at 25.5 million tonnes between February to June 2023
Dmitry Patrushev, Russia's Minister of Agriculture has proposed setting the nation's grain export quota between February 15 to June 20, 2023 at 25.5 million tonnes, Reuters reported.
